    Family
    Over the course of the strip, Gafield has shared information on members of his family:

    Uncle Arno — Known for saying, "Life is like a festival; you have to get out there and enjoy it." He was run over by a parade.[15]
    Uncle Barney — Once went to the vet and came back as Garfield's Aunt Bernice.[16]
    Uncle Berle — Described as crazy and thought he was a dog. He always chased himself up trees and was constantly exhausted as a result.[17]
    Uncle Bernie — Coined the phrases, "Never listen for a train by putting your ear on a train track," and "Curiosity killed the cat," in that order.[18]
    Uncle Bob — Used to say, "Slow down, take it easy," before being hit by a bus.[19]
    Uncle Ed — Described as crazy, he liked to sniff waffle irons, and his face was used for tic-tac-toe games.[20] He also always said, "Never belch out loud," and blew out an eyeball one day.[21] However, this may be a different Uncle Ed.
    Aunt Edna — Used to say, "Let a smile be your umbrella," until her dentures were blown clean through the garage door by a bolt of lightning.[22] She also married a hyena.[23]
    Aunt Evelyn — Plucked all her hair from her body to stop shedding. She currently resides in L.A., with a family that thinks she is a chihuahua.[24]
    Uncle Harry — He lived in a gas plant in Gas City, Indiana. He was a famous mouser, eventually chasing a mouse into Tank #2. He is now a paperweight in Bayonne, New Jersey.[25]
    Uncle Hubert — Once caught a 30-pound canary in Chicago, and was last spotted over Dallas, Texas. For this reason, Garfield does not chase birds.[26]
    Uncle Leo — Always had a smile until an incident with denture weevils.[27]
    Uncle Morty — Was killed by his gluttony, after trying to take a papaya from a silverback gorilla.[28]
    Uncle Nick — Loved to destroy things and used to eat chickens whole. There are two conflicting statements to his current status, however. In one strip, it is said that he tried to swallow an ostrich after he mistook it for a chicken, with his last words being, "That's the biggest chicken I ever saw."[29] In another, it is stated that he is presently a postal employee in Chicago.[30]
    Uncle Patrick — Famous for the quote, "I regret that I have but nine lives to give to my country."[31]
    Great Uncle Ralph — The only mention of Great Uncle Ralph claims he was a warthog.[32]
    Aunt Reba — Garfield reacts with her name when Jon revealed that his tennis racket was strung with catgut.[33]
    Uncle Roy — Said to be weird, he underwent a species change operation that transformed him into a dog; He later chased himself to death.[34]
    There are also two unnamed uncles and one great uncle. One uncle went to the vet once and had his brain replaced with that of a chicken. The rest of his life was spent sitting on eggs in grocery stores.[35] Another uncle used to play with yarn, and is now a pattern in an angora sweater.[36] The great uncle was a lion who ate a sick monkey.[37]
    Cousin Sly - A mouser. Appeared in Garfield on the Town.
    Raoul - Garfield's half-brother, a mouser.
